python 日期加一天

在Python中,日期和时间的处理可以通过内置的datetime模块来完成,如果你需要给一个日期加上一天,可以使用datetime模块中的timedelta对象,以下是详细的步骤和示例代码:

python 日期加一天
(图片来源网络,侵删)

1. 导入必要的模块

你需要导入datetime模块。

import datetime

2. 获取当前日期

使用datetime模块的datetime.now()函数可以获取当前的日期和时间,如果你想只获取日期部分,可以使用date()方法。

current_date = datetime.datetime.now().date()
print("当前日期:", current_date)

3. 使用timedelta加一天

datetime.timedelta用于表示两个日期或时间之间的差值,你可以创建一个timedelta对象,表示一天的时间差,并将其加到当前日期上。

one_day = datetime.timedelta(days=1)
next_date = current_date + one_day
print("加一天后的日期:", next_date)

4. 格式化输出

如果你想要格式化输出日期,可以使用strftime方法,按照"年月日"的格式输出。

formatted_date = next_date.strftime("%Y%m%d")
print("格式化后的日期:", formatted_date)

完整代码示例

将以上步骤放在一起,完整的代码如下:

import datetime
获取当前日期
current_date = datetime.datetime.now().date()
print("当前日期:", current_date)
创建timedelta对象,表示一天
one_day = datetime.timedelta(days=1)
将一天加到当前日期上
next_date = current_date + one_day
print("加一天后的日期:", next_date)
格式化输出日期
formatted_date = next_date.strftime("%Y%m%d")
print("格式化后的日期:", formatted_date)

补充说明

timedelta不仅可以用于加天数,还可以用于加减小时、分钟、秒等。

strftime方法提供了多种日期和时间的格式化选项,可以根据需要进行选择。

通过上述步骤和代码,你可以轻松地在Python中给日期加上一天,并且可以按照不同的格式输出结果。

原创文章,作者:酷盾叔,如若转载,请注明出处:https://www.kdun.com/ask/303308.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
酷盾叔订阅
上一篇 2024-03-04 00:16
下一篇 2024-03-04 00:18

相关推荐

  • Difftime是什么?探索时间差计算的奥秘

    “difftime” 是一个计算两个时间点之间差异的函数,常用于编程中处理日期和时间。

    2024-11-14
    07
  • MySQL减法运算中,如何正确处理日期与时间数据类型的相减,以获取精确的时间差?

    MySQL 日期与时间数据类型减法操作1. 引言在MySQL中,日期与时间数据类型可以用于存储日期、时间和日期时间值,这些数据类型允许用户进行日期和时间的加法、减法等运算,本节将详细介绍如何在MySQL中使用减法操作来处理日期和时间数据,2. 减法操作类型MySQL中的日期与时间减法操作主要有以下几种类型:日期……

    2024-10-02
    045
  • 如何在MySQL数据库中计算时间差?

    在MySQL数据库中,可以使用DATEDIFF()函数或TIMESTAMPDIFF()函数来计算两个日期之间的差值。DATEDIFF()函数返回两个日期之间的天数差,而TIMESTAMPDIFF()函数可以指定单位(如秒、分钟、小时等)并返回相应的时间差。

    2024-08-03
    020
  • php 纽约时区 _PHP

    在PHP中,处理日期和时间是很常见的需求,特别是当涉及到不同时区时,我们需要确保我们的应用程序可以正确地显示和处理时间,纽约位于东部标准时间(EST)时区,UTC5,在本文中,我们将探讨如何在PHP中处理纽约时区。PHP日期和时间函数PHP提供了许多内置的日期和时间函数,可以帮助我们处理不同的时区,以下是一些常……

    2024-06-08
    0135

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入